November 12, 2024
Unlock Your Financial Future: Make the Most of Lower Interest Rates Today
Mashudu Lavhengwa, Junior Economist at Metropolitan, shares insights on the recent 25-basis-point interest rate cut by the South African Reserve Bank, which brings the repo rate to 8%. While the cut may seem small, it can have a noticeable impact, particularly for those with significant debt.

October 9, 2024
Are you financially prepared for a critical illness?
According to Bertie Nel, Head of Financial Planning and Advice at Momentum, the Momentum Life Insurance 2023 claims statistics paint a stark picture of the financial unpreparedness that comes with life-altering illnesses. Most death claims were for cardiovascular and cancer-related illnesses, but more than 80% of these clients didn’t have critical illness cover in place.
